UPDATE: Coquitlam SAR retrieve two lost hikers at Buntzen Lake

Two lost hikers were rescued by Coquitlam SAR on July 9, 2015. Global News

UPDATE: The two male hikers, who went missing Wednesday afternoon, have been recovered safely from Buntzen Lake by Coquitlam SAR this morning. 

Coquitlam Search and Rescue are looking for a pair of hikers that went missing on Wednesday at Buntzen Lake.

The two men, one in his sixties and the other in his twenties, got lost after entering the forest but were able to use their cell phone to call the older man’s spouse. The pair initially believed they could make it out but realized they were in trouble as night fell, said Coquitlam SAR manager Michael Coyle.

SAR was called in at 11 p.m. last night and were able to make voice contact in the early hours of this morning.

Searchers say they hope to walk the pair out with the morning daylight.
